Dale's climate presents specific considerations for RV boat storage. Our hot, humid summers and occasional winter freezes mean your storage choice needs to provide protection from UV damage, temperature extremes, and moisture. Many local facilities offer covered or fully enclosed storage options that shield your boat from the relentless Texas sun and unpredictable hail storms. When touring storage facilities, look for features like proper ventilation to prevent mold and mildew buildup inside your boat's compartments—a common issue in our humid environment.

When selecting an RV boat storage facility in Dale, consider both security and accessibility. Look for facilities with gated access, security cameras, and good lighting. Since many boat owners in our area also own RVs, some facilities offer combined storage options that can accommodate both your boat and RV in one convenient location. This dual storage approach can be particularly valuable during hurricane season when you might need to secure multiple recreational vehicles quickly.
Before committing to a storage facility, take measurements of your boat with the trailer attached, including the height with any towers or antennas. Many Dale storage facilities have height restrictions, especially for covered spaces. Also, check local regulations about fluid drainage and maintenance—some facilities allow minor maintenance work on-site, while others prohibit it. Don't forget to properly winterize your boat even in our relatively mild Texas winters, as occasional freezes can still cause significant damage to unprotected engines and plumbing.
